The energy conservation analysis of the heat pipe indirect evaporative cooling air conditioning system used in the building
According to the material statistics, Chinese GDP occupies world GDP probably is 4%, the primary energy and the raw material consumption has actually accounted for the global ultimate output 30%, construction energy consumption occupies the national energy consumption 30%, the air conditioning energy consumption accounts for construction energy consumption about 60%. Therefore vigorously does the energy conservation work in the heating air conditioning domain, is one of the main ways contribution to the energy conservation.We proposed a new energy conservation air conditioning system-the heat pipe indirect evaporation cooling air conditioning system. This air conditioning system can recycle the cool exist in the inside air to pre-cool the outside fresh air in the summer, and recycle the heat exist in the inside air to preheat outside air in the winter.The whole system only needs the air blower and the water pump energy consumption, without other exterior powers. Through experimental confirmation, we found that when outside air temperature above 30℃, use this air conditioning system can make temperature drop reaches above 5 -6 ℃ in the summer, the indirect evaporation efficiency may reach about 60-65 %. In the winter, the heat recycle efficiency also may reach about 60%, the energy conservation effect is obvious. Especially suit for the northwest regions where have dry climate. The system structure, the principle of operation, the experimental study of this air conditioning system and its use in the building will be presented in this paper to analysis the energy conservation effect.
